Superman Returns Movie
There have been numerous versions of the Superman story, beginning with the comic book. This was followed by several radio and TV series and movies. We hadn't heard from him for a while but the Superman Returns movie created interest in the super hero once more. The film did well at the box office, holding its own against other blockbusters, when it was released in 2006. Old fans of Clarke Kent's altar ego were keen to see the new portrayal and the younger generation was curious about it.
Directed by Bryan Singer, the movie featured a largely unknown actor called Brandon Routh in the title role. Daredevil reporter Lois Lane is played by Kate Bosworth and Sam Huntington is the Daily Planet's young photographer, Jimmy. The newspaper's editor, Perry White, is played by Frank Langella, a familiar face to many moviegoers. Another screen veteran, Eva Marie Saint, plays Kent's mom, Martha. The Superman Returns movie benefited from the involvement of Kevin Spacey, who had fun with the role of villainous Lex Luther.
The comic hero had not been seen on the big screen since the series of films, starring the late Christopher Reeve. Marlon Brando, also now departed, had played the part of Superman's father, Jor-El in the first of these. Footage from his scenes is used in Superman Returns. The movie was praised for its cast and special effects and no one will be surprised if there is a sequel or two.
The film picks up the story where Superman has been absent from Earth for five years. He has been on a quest to find his home planet of Krypton, only to find its remains. He goes back to Earth to perform heroic deeds once more and to re-ignite his relationship with Lois. Of course, he has to fight his nemesis, Luthor along the way. To complicate things, Lois Lane has a son and the question of who is the father adds to the plot. The Superman Returns movie was nominated for the Best Visual Effects awards in 2007 at the Oscars and at the British Baftas.
